Analysis

In 2011, crop production index in Madagascar stood at 130.16 gross, 1999-2001 = 100. That is the highest value across all 51 years on record.

The figure is up 3.5% on the previous year and up 47.0% over ten years.

Over the whole period, crop production index in Madagascar peaked at 130.16 gross, 1999-2001 = 100 in 2011 and was at its lowest, 43.03 gross, 1999-2001 = 100, in 1961.

Madagascar ranks 15th of 53 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 51 years of available data.

Crop production index shows agricultural production for each year relative to the base period 2004-2006. It includes all crops except fodder crops. Regional and income group aggregates for the FAO's production indexes are calculated from the underlying values in international dollars, normalized to the base period 2004-2006.
